物联网项目管理软件有哪些?全面解析主流工具与选型策略
随着物联网(IoT)技术在工业制造、智慧城市、智慧医疗、农业监控等领域的广泛应用,企业对高效、协同的项目管理工具需求日益增长。物联网项目不同于传统IT项目,其复杂性体现在设备接入、数据流处理、边缘计算部署和多系统集成等多个维度。因此,选择合适的物联网项目管理软件成为项目成功的关键一环。
一、物联网项目管理软件的核心功能是什么?
物联网项目管理软件不仅仅是简单的任务分配或进度跟踪工具,它必须具备以下核心能力:
- 设备生命周期管理:从设备注册、配置、固件升级到退役全过程可视化管理。
- 数据采集与可视化仪表盘:支持多协议接入(如MQTT、CoAP、HTTP),实时展示传感器数据、告警状态等。
- 团队协作与权限控制:基于角色的访问控制(RBAC),支持跨部门协作,如开发、运维、测试人员的角色分工。
- 自动化工作流引擎:通过规则引擎实现异常自动响应,例如当温湿度超标时触发通知或关闭阀门。
- API开放与集成能力:可无缝对接ERP、CRM、MES等企业现有系统,构建统一数字平台。
二、市面上主流的物联网项目管理软件有哪些?
1. AWS IoT SiteWise
AWS IoT SiteWise 是亚马逊云科技推出的工业物联网平台,专为工厂自动化和设备监控设计。它提供强大的设备建模能力,允许用户定义设备属性、关系和行为逻辑,并通过预置仪表板快速生成可视化界面。适用于制造业、能源等行业的大规模设备管理场景。
2. Microsoft Azure IoT Hub + Power BI
微软Azure IoT Hub 提供高可靠的消息传输服务,结合Power BI 实现高级数据分析与报表展示。该组合特别适合需要深度数据洞察的企业,例如预测性维护、能耗优化等场景。其优势在于与Microsoft生态系统的深度集成(如Teams、Excel、Dynamics 365)。
3. ThingsBoard
ThingsBoard 是一个开源且功能丰富的物联网平台,支持设备管理、规则引擎、可视化面板和远程控制。其社区版免费使用,企业版提供更高级的功能如多租户支持、SaaS模式部署。非常适合中小型企业和初创公司快速搭建原型并迭代产品。
4. IBM Watson IoT Platform
IBM 的物联网平台整合了AI分析能力,能够从海量设备数据中挖掘模式,用于故障诊断、流程优化等。其优势在于与IBM Cloud Pak for Data 和 Red Hat OpenShift 的深度集成,适合大型企业进行数字化转型。
5. Blynk / Node-RED + MQTT Broker
对于嵌入式开发者或DIY爱好者来说,Blynk 提供低代码移动应用开发环境;而Node-RED则是一个基于流的编程工具,可用于构建复杂的物联网自动化流程。两者配合MQTT消息中间件,可实现轻量级但灵活的项目管理方案。
三、如何选择适合你的物联网项目管理软件?
1. 明确项目目标与规模
如果项目涉及数百甚至数千个终端设备,建议选择云端托管的SaaS平台(如AWS、Azure)以获得弹性扩展能力;若仅用于小范围试点或教学实验,开源工具如ThingsBoard可能更具性价比。
2. 考察安全性与合规性
物联网设备易受攻击,软件必须支持TLS加密通信、设备身份认证(如X.509证书)、审计日志等功能。尤其在医疗、金融等行业,需符合GDPR、HIPAA等法规要求。
3. 评估集成能力和API丰富度
好的物联网项目管理软件应提供标准API接口(RESTful、gRPC),便于与企业内部系统对接。同时,是否支持常见的协议(如Modbus、OPC UA、LoRaWAN)也是重要考量因素。
4. 关注社区活跃度与技术支持
开源项目如ThingsBoard有活跃的GitHub社区和文档库;商业软件如AWS IoT则提供7x24小时客户支持。选择时要权衡成本与售后保障。
5. 成本结构透明化
部分平台按设备数量计费,有些按流量或存储空间收费。务必了解潜在隐藏费用(如API调用次数限制、高级功能附加费),避免后期预算超支。
四、典型应用场景案例分享
案例1:某汽车零部件制造商部署AWS IoT SiteWise
该企业在工厂部署了超过500台工业传感器用于监测振动、温度和压力参数。借助SiteWise,他们实现了设备健康度评分、异常趋势预警,并将数据同步至MES系统用于质量追溯。项目上线后,非计划停机时间减少30%,维护成本下降20%。
案例2:智慧农业项目采用ThingsBoard + Raspberry Pi
一家农业科技公司利用ThingsBoard搭建农田环境监控系统,每个大棚配备温湿度、光照强度传感器并通过LoRa网络上传数据。农民可通过手机APP查看作物生长状态,系统自动调节灌溉阀门。整个项目开发周期仅两周,总投入低于5万元人民币。
五、未来趋势:AI驱动的智能物联网项目管理
未来的物联网项目管理软件将更加智能化。例如:
- AI异常检测:利用机器学习模型识别设备运行中的异常模式,提前发出预警。
- 自然语言交互:通过语音指令查询设备状态或下达操作命令(如“帮我检查车间A的空调是否正常”)。
- 数字孪生集成:将物理设备映射到虚拟空间,模拟不同工况下的表现,辅助决策优化。
- 区块链溯源:确保设备数据不可篡改,提升供应链透明度。
六、结语:做好物联网项目管理,选对工具是第一步
物联网项目管理软件不仅是技术工具,更是组织数字化能力的体现。从设备接入到数据分析,从团队协作到持续运营,每一环节都离不开专业平台的支持。企业应根据自身业务特点、预算和技术成熟度,科学评估并选择最适合的解决方案。只有这样,才能真正释放物联网的价值,推动业务创新与效率提升。

